The zero minimum deposit on Standard accounts means you can start with any amount you are comfortable risking. Whether that is $10 or $500, the decision is entirely yours. This removes the pressure of committing significant capital before you have developed confidence in your trading approach.

The Standard Cent account takes accessibility further by allowing trades in cent lots, where 1 lot equals just 1,000 units of currency instead of the standard 100,000. This means a beginner can experience real market conditions with positions worth just $10-20, learning to manage risk without the psychological pressure of larger positions.

Negative balance protection is applied to all accounts, ensuring you can never owe more than your deposit regardless of how volatile the market becomes. This is a critical safety net during the learning phase when risk management skills are still developing.

Getting Started with Exness: Step by Step

Opening an Exness account takes less than 10 minutes. Here is the process we walked through during our testing:

  1. Registration: Provide your email address and set a password. Exness will send a verification email.
  2. Verification: Upload a government-issued ID and proof of address. Verification typically completes within 24 hours, though many traders report same-day approval.
  3. Choose Account Type: Select Standard (recommended for beginners) or Standard Cent (for micro-lot practice).
  4. Deposit Funds: Use any deposit method. No minimum required on Standard accounts. Deposits via e-wallets and cards are instant.
  5. Download Platform: Install MetaTrader 4/5 or use the Exness Terminal web platform directly from your browser.
  6. Start with Demo: We strongly recommend practicing on a demo account for at least 2-4 weeks before trading with real money.

Platform Walkthrough

Exness offers three platform options, each suited to different preferences:

MetaTrader 5 is the most feature-rich option, offering advanced charting, 80+ technical indicators, automated trading via Expert Advisors, and a built-in economic calendar. The learning curve is steeper than simpler platforms, but MT5 is the industry standard that most educational content references.

Exness Terminal is a web-based platform ideal for beginners who want to start trading without installing software. It features a clean, modern interface with one-click trading, advanced charting powered by TradingView technology, and real-time market analysis. If you are not sure which platform to choose, start here.

Exness Trade App provides mobile trading with full functionality including charts, order management, deposits, and withdrawals. The biometric authentication adds security, and push notifications keep you informed of price movements and order fills.

Copy Trading: Learn by Observing

Exness Social Trading is a powerful feature for beginners. It allows you to browse profiles of experienced strategy providers, review their historical performance, risk scores, and trading styles, then automatically copy their trades proportionally to your account size.

This approach offers two key benefits for beginners. First, it provides immediate market exposure while you are still learning, allowing your capital to work while you develop your own skills. Second, observing how successful traders manage positions, set stop losses, and react to market events provides practical education that no textbook can replicate.

You can start copy trading with as little as $10, and you retain full control to stop copying at any time. Strategy provider fees are transparent, and Exness does not charge additional platform fees for the copy trading service.

Understanding Trading Costs

On the Standard account, trading costs are straightforward: you pay the spread, and there is no commission. For EUR/USD, the average spread is 0.8-1.0 pips during active market hours, which translates to a cost of $8-10 per standard lot trade. For a beginner trading mini lots (0.1 lots), this cost drops to just $0.80-1.00 per trade.

Swap rates for overnight positions are competitive, and Exness offers swap-free accounts for traders who need them. There are no deposit fees, no withdrawal fees, and no inactivity fees. This transparent fee structure means there are no surprises eating into your learning capital.

Safety and Regulation

Exness holds licenses from multiple tier-1 regulators:

  • FCA (UK): The Financial Conduct Authority enforces strict capital requirements and FSCS compensation up to GBP 85,000.
  • CySEC (Cyprus): European regulation with negative balance protection and the Investor Compensation Fund.
  • FSCA (South Africa): Regulatory oversight for African and international clients.

Client funds are segregated from the company's operational capital, held at major international banks. Exness publishes monthly financial reports and audited trading volumes, providing a level of transparency that builds confidence for new traders entrusting their first deposits to a broker.
